Spring Cleaning in the Yard

Everyone thinks of indoor chores for their spring cleaning projects, but the exterior of the home and the yard need a little TLC too. Here are a few tips to help you put your home's best face forward along with getting the lawn and garden in shape for a great spring growth.

Removing Debris. You may have raked up all those leaves during fall clean up, but after those winter storms, there are bound to be leaves, branches, and trash that have lodged themselves in your lawn and amidst the rose bushes.

Cleaning Your Deck. For those of you with a deck, regular upkeep is important. Wood decks get worn and dried out by exposure to sunlight, temperatures changes, and general foot traffic. Cleaning it with a biodegradable deck cleaner is one step, and you may also consider resealing it as well.

Weeding. Nobody likes this one, but if you do a good job with teasing out the invasive plants now, you'll save yourself a lot of time come June. After weeding around the flowerbeds, you might consider putting down rubber mulch. It can help reduce weed growth, and it's environmentally friendly.

Window Washing. Take time to clean up the outside faces of windows to bring more light into your home. Consider using vinegar for an environmentally friendly solution to clean them up.

Tending to Outdoor Furniture. Wiping and hosing down plastic lawn furniture can be relatively simple. However, wicker furniture may need a little extra love. Use a mild oil-based soap to do the trick. Be sure to rinse frequently to keep the dirt from lodging in the crevices.

These spring cleaning tips should get you started. Soon enough, you'll be able to enjoy your outdoor space and look forward to a pleasant place to spend warm spring afternoons. Enjoy!
